PRN Athletic Trainer

HARTZ Physical Therapy is seeking a PRN Licensed Athletic Trainer to provide as needed coverage at a local high school. (There are no guaranteed hours with this position, but the potential for up to 160 hours between approximately August 1, 2021 and June 10, 2022.) Candidates need to be flexible and able to provide on-call coverage Monday-Friday 3:00pm-10:00pm and some Saturdays as the need arises. The qualified individual is responsible for providing athletic training services at the site (local high school) under contract with HARTZ Physical Therapy.

Minimum Requirements:

  • A Bachelor of Science degree in Athletic Training from an accredited institution.
  • Current certification as an Athletic Trainer through the National Athletic Trainers Association (NATA) and Board of Certification (BOC)
  • Current PA State License in Athletic Training
  • CPR Healthcare/BLS Certification
  • Valid PA Driver’s License
  • PA Child Abuse (Act 151), PA Criminal Background Check (Act 34) and FBI Fingerprinting Clearances

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Participation in the coverage of school athletic events and practices
  • Recognize and evaluate injuries (within the scope of practice)
  • Provide first aid/emergency care
  • Determine the need for and administer proper athletic training techniques prior to and during athletic events and practices to decrease risk of injury.
  • Athletic training techniques include: taping, wrapping, bandaging, and bracing, proper hydration and minor wound care.
  • Keep detailed reports on injuries and documentation of care provided.
  • Communicate effectively with co-workers, athletes, parents, physicians, coaches, and all school personnel in a professional manner via verbal and written skills
